The iTunesX.pkg for iTunes 5.0 is interesting from a certain point of view: The fact is that the permissions for /Library are/shall be drwxrwxr-t (because of Mac OS X Tiger). This has no influence since the IFPkgFlagOverwritePermissions is NO. Is there still no Technote or QA or documentation describing what the permissions shall be for the common folders? I haven't found one yet. BTW, is the "requiredSLA" key a private key to state that if the update is made via Software Update it's required to display the Software Licence Agreement?
